2. BLOSSOM DC

Where/When: Old Print Gallery (1220 31st Street, NW), Opening Reception is Friday, March 16 from 5 p.m. to 8 p.m

Why Go: The show features prints from local artists as well as NY-based artists. According to the event website, it was "inspired by the 100 year anniversary of the gift of cherry trees from Japan to Washington, DC." BLOSSOM DC will be on view until May 11.

Pricing: Free.
